Engadget Podcast 135 - 02.27.2009

After last week's international extravaganza from MWC, everybody's back in the land of freedom and opportunity for this week's Engadget Podcast. Josh, Nilay and Paul chat up the Kindle 2 in matters both philosophical and legal, Josh brags about his new non-glossy MacBook Pro 17-incher, and things get really heated when the red Xbox 360 comes up for debate. Don't worry, very few zombies were harmed in the formation of these disparate opinions.
